Mercury-free level switches

Oct. 25, 2007
The Tri-Magnet Switch can replace mercury-based level switches without removing the existing chamber.

There are several available switches: a 10-A switch is for general-purpose duties up to 480°F; a 5-A switch for applications up to 750°F; and a hermetically sealed switch for low temperatures, contaminated atmosphere environments, and intrinsically safe circuits. All moving parts and contacts are enclosed in a stainless-steel enclosure filled with an inert gas. Single and double-pull-switch models are available.
